Control two separate lights or devices from a single location with this combination switch. Designed to emulate the sleek lines of the collection's paddle switches, it delivers flexible, space-saving control with the sophisticated look of radiant. Made exclusively for use with screwless Wall Plates from the radiant® Collection, sold separately.

Features

  • Offers installation flexibility with space-saving style, as part of the extensive offering from the radiant® Collection.
  • Features durable, high-impact resistant thermoplastic construction.
  • Designed to install easily with a narrower back body and captivated mounting screws.
  • Patented Snap-In Light Module (sold separately) transforms a combination switch into an illuminated switch in seconds.
  • More color options available to fit any style, including finishes to match current hardware and lighting trends.
  • Complete the look with a sleek, screwless radiant® Wall Plate, and coordinate with other designer switches and outlets available from the radiant® Collection.

Rated 2 out of 5 by from Flawed ergonomic design The switch itself is solidly built and the individual rockers have a nice feel, but I have grown to loathe the vertical orientation of the rockers, especially because there is absolutely no separation between the upper and lower toggles and therefore it is hard to distinguish by feel where one ends and the other begins. They are so close together that when I attempt to turn off the upper rocker I often end up turning on the lower rocker at the same time. Conversely, when I try to turn on the lower rocker I often inadvertently turn off the upper rocker as well. In my case this situation is exacerbated because I frequently try to operate them blindly, reaching around one side of the wall at the end of a hallway to the kitchen wall where they are located. While I readily admit that my tactile sensitivity isn't what it was when I was younger, I think even 20-year-old me would have a tough time operating these switches blindly without unintentionally hitting both at once.

I have a rcd11wcc6 switch that I want to install. I have power coming from a junction box to the switch and I want to control a ceiling fan and an a separate light. How would I go about hooking up the 3 wires to the Com A, Com B, SP A,and the SP B?

Asked by: Tony
You need to connect your HOT wire to either COM A or COM B and leave the Split Circuit tab in on the back of the switch. Your fan and light wires get connected to SP A and SP B.

If com A port is hot wired can com B port be used as additional split port port.  Using slit a and b

Asked by: Rookiebulb
The RCD11W Radiant cmbination switch(SP/SP) can be wired using two HOT wires to COM A and COM B. You will also need to remove the split circuit tab on the back of the device to complete the installation
